Tim - Master Jeweler and Numismatist, started his career in 1985 by attending North Bennett Street Industrial School in Boston, MA. During that time, Tim apprenticed at the Jewelers Building where he studied and worked hands on creating fine jewelery. Through hard work and dedication, Valley Jewelers opened in Spring 1987. Later, Tim became a state juried member of The New Hampshire League of Craftsman in 1996 based on his talent. Tim had an interest in coins as early as 6 years old and continued to buy, sell, and trade coins right up to today. He is very much an expert in buying and selling coins, precious metals, and jewelry. Tim pursued his lifelong passion and knowledge of fine jewelry and numismatics into a reputable established business. He is more than willing to help folks best understand the history and value of their coins, collections, fine jewelry and estate jewelry. It's been Tim's ambition to continue to offer the public outstanding value, highest quality, exceptional service, expert advice for over 25 years.

Steve - Master Jeweler and Artisan, joined Valley Jewelers in 1989. Influenced and encouraged by his younger brother Tim, Steve was introduced to and mentored by Tim to build on his talent for making fine jewelry. Steve quickly transformed himself into a technical bench jeweler by working with gold, silver, platinum, diamonds, and gemstones. Later, he went on to gain an education around the knowledge and use of laser welding technology. Over the years, Steve gained invaluable experience with his vision for design, antique restoration, goldsmithing, stone setting, engraving, fabrication, electroplating, forging, and polishing. We are very honored to have such a talented, dedicated in-house handcrafted, custom made jeweler to craft the best quality jewelry for you.
